PersianMedQA: Evaluating Large Language Models on a Persian-English Bilingual Medical Question Answering Benchmark

大型语言模型(LLMs)在众多自然语言处理基准上表现卓越,常超越人类水平。然而,其在医疗等高风险领域,尤其是在低资源语言中的可靠性仍待深入探索。本文提出PersianMedQA,一个包含20,785道由专家验证的波斯语多选医学题的大规模数据集,源自伊朗14年国家医学考试,涵盖23个医学专科,旨在评估模型在波斯语和英语双语环境下的表现。我们对41个先进模型(包括通用、波斯语及医疗专用模型)在零样本与思维链(CoT)设置下进行评测。结果显示,封闭权重通用模型(如GPT-4.1)持续领先,波斯语中准确率达83.09%,英语中为80.7%;而波斯语专用模型(如Dorna)表现显著偏低(波斯语仅34.9%),普遍在指令遵循与领域推理上存在困难。我们还分析了翻译影响,发现尽管英语表现整体更高,但3-10%的问题因文化与临床上下文丢失,仅在波斯语中可正确解答。最后,证明模型大小不足以保证稳健表现,必须结合领域或语言适配。PersianMedQA为双语与文化相关医疗推理评估提供基础。数据集及双语医学词典已公开:https://huggingface.co/datasets/MohammadJRanjbar/PersianMedQA。

Large Language Models (LLMs) have achieved remarkable performance on a wide range of Natural Language Processing (NLP) benchmarks, often surpassing human-level accuracy. However, their reliability in high-stakes domains such as medicine, particularly in low-resource languages, remains underexplored. In this work, we introduce PersianMedQA, a large-scale dataset of 20,785 expert-validated multiple-choice Persian medical questions from 14 years of Iranian national medical exams, spanning 23 medical specialties and designed to evaluate LLMs in both Persian and English. We benchmark 41 state-of-the-art models, including general-purpose, Persian, and medical LLMs, in zero-shot and chain-of-thought (CoT) settings. Our results show that closed-weight general models (e.g., GPT-4.1) consistently outperform all other categories, achieving 83.09% accuracy in Persian and 80.7% in English, while Persian LLMs such as Dorna underperform significantly (e.g., 34.9% in Persian), often struggling with both instruction-following and domain reasoning. We also analyze the impact of translation, showing that while English performance is generally higher, 3-10% of questions can only be answered correctly in Persian due to cultural and clinical contextual cues that are lost in translation. Finally, we demonstrate that model size alone is insufficient for robust performance without strong domain or language adaptation. PersianMedQA provides a foundation for evaluating bilingual and culturally grounded medical reasoning in LLMs. The dataset, along with a bilingual medical dictionary, is available: https://huggingface.co/datasets/MohammadJRanjbar/PersianMedQA .
